Mesa V-Twin Version Two. For those of you that don't know the series two has two internal trim pots for setting the gain between the different modes. On the original version there was a pretty big volume jump between the different O/D modes, but this is fixed here. This Pedal sounds really cool, and has some nice features. It can drive a poweramp, has a headphone/line out. This has some scratches on the cover, but internally its all good. I had a tech go over it when I got, we cleaned the pots and its good as new sounding. Only slight issue is that the power jack, doesn't catch on the Plug very well. As long as you don't kick the pedal hard, it stays in. I might recommend taping the plug in or replacing the Jack. These go on Ebay for $300 regularly, I will do $275 shipped here. SOLD
